Subject: RE: How to import multiple stylesheets into one xsl file?
From: "Michael Kay" <mhk@xxxxxxxxx>
Date: Fri, 20 Aug 2004 09:24:52 +0100
RE:  How to import multiple stylesheets into one xsl fi
> It worked perfectly! This helped a lot!
> 
> I'm still wondering about one thing though. I was
> using <xsl:import> in the template after the
> <xsl:output>tag on the Apache server installed on my
> Windows XP computer and it worked very well. For
> example,
> 
> <xsl:stylesheet>
> <xsl:output>
> <xsl:template match="/">
> <html>
> ...
> <body>
> <table>
> <xsl:import href="header.xsl" />

Any XSLT processor that allows this is *very* buggy! xsl:import is permitted
only at the top level, as a child of xsl:stylesheet.

As always with bugs, you can do your supplier a favour by reporting the bug,
or you can simply switch to a different product.
